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3809332683 526673 123399 1313350
5441 837386774 986152383
5441 837386774 986152383
107620 849986398 59333 734652
All about undefined
Interested in learning more?
5441 837386774 986152383
107620 849986398 59333 734652
See more
15717 59 2485674294
2833554022 10524626 8663
See more
106313632 3144404 61655
5418501 3615603 011 4809
See more